S&P Global Ratings assigned its 'SP-1+' short-term rating to Hudson County Improvement Authority, N.J.'s series 2020B county-guaranteed pooled notes, consisting of tax-exempt series 2020B-1 and federally taxable series 2020B-2 notes, issued for Hudson County, and affirmed its 'SP-1+' short-term rating on the authority's existing notes. At the same time, S&P Global Ratings also affirmed its 'AA' long-term rating, with a stable outlook, on Hudson County's general obligation (GO) debt and the authority's GO-backed debt and its 'AA-' long-term rating and underlying rating (SPUR), with a stable outlook, on the county's appropriation-backed obligations. Officials intend to use series 2020B governmental-pooled note proceeds to make loans to certain municipal borrowers--including Bayonne, Weehawken Township, and Union City--to finance capital projects and renew notes;
